Uploaded image for project: 'Maven'
  1. Maven
  2. MNG-2446

parent Pom properties not resolved for module dependencies

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Duplicate
    • Affects Version/s: 2.0.4
    • Fix Version/s: None
    • Component/s: Dependencies
    • Labels:
      None
    • Environment:
      WindowsXP/Linux - JDK 1.4 last version

      Description

      root-project --> root-pom.xml with <version>${my.version}</version>

      ------->proj1 <parent><version>${my.version}</version></parent>
      ------->proj2 <parent><version>${my.version}</version></parent>
       
        ->proj1 dependency
      ------->proj3 <parent><version>${my.version}</version></parent>

      if I compile from the root-project directory, all compile fine.

      if I compile from the proj2 directory, maven2 resolve proj2-${my.version}
      resolve proj1-${my.version}
      but tries to resolve the parent version root-project-${my.version} but this is not resolved.

        Attachments

        1. InstallMojo.quoteReplacement.patch
          0.6 kB
          Henrik Brautaset Aronsen
        2. maven-version-problem.zip
          2 kB
          Henrik Brautaset Aronsen

          Issue Links

            Activity

              People

              • Assignee:
                brettporter Brett Porter
                Reporter:
                lapoutre Jeremie Poutrin
              • Votes:
                11 Vote for this issue
                Watchers:
                5 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: